About Philippe Vain
Philippe Vain is a scholar working on Molecular Biology, Plant Science, Biotechnology, Ecology, Evolution, Behavior and Systematics and Cell Biology, having authored 41 papers that have together received 3.2k indexed citations. Recurring topics across this work include Plant tissue culture and regeneration (34 papers), Transgenic Plants and Applications (16 papers), Chromosomal and Genetic Variations (12 papers), Plant Genetic and Mutation Studies (9 papers), Plant Virus Research Studies (9 papers), CRISPR and Genetic Engineering (8 papers), Plant Molecular Biology Research (5 papers) and Genetically Modified Organisms Research (5 papers). The work is most often cited by research in Biotechnology (948 citations), Plant Science (2.5k citations), Molecular Biology (2.4k citations), Endocrinology (129 citations) and Horticulture (18 citations). Philippe Vain has collaborated with scholars based in United Kingdom, United States and France. Frequent co-authors include John J. Finer, B. Worland, J. W. Snape, Olivier Voinnet, David C. Baulcombe, Susan Angell, Vera Thole, Paul Christou, Ajay Kohli and Michael Bevan. Their work appears in journals such as Theoretical and Applied Genetics, Plant Cell Reports, Plant Biotechnology Journal, The Plant Journal and Molecular Breeding.
